Established in 1950, Greenbelt Park is more than just a patch of green. It’s a living testament to nature’s power to reclaim and renew. Originally intended as part of Greenbelt city’s greenbelt, the park’s southern portion now thrives under the care of the National Park Service. Imagine the Algonquin tribes who once hunted and fished on this land. They lived in harmony with the forests and streams, long before colonists arrived and transformed the landscape into farmland. Over time, the land was depleted, and farming ceased. Erosion scarred the hillsides, a stark reminder of unsustainable practices. Yet, nature, in her infinite wisdom, began the slow process of healing. By the early 1900s, a vibrant mix of pine and deciduous trees emerged. This rebirth paved the way for the Greenbelt Park we know today. Today, Greenbelt Park offers a network of trails for exploration. The 5.3-mile Perimeter Trail beckons hikers and horseback riders, while shorter nature trails like the Azalea, Dogwood, and Blueberry trails offer glimpses into diverse ecosystems. Three picnic areas provide spots to relax and enjoy the scenery. For those seeking a longer stay, the campground offers 174 sites.
